When you're browsing the web with Firefox and want to save your current web page to Todoist, use the Todoist extension to do it in just a few clicks.

View your Todoist task list
To get a quick look at Todoist from your browser, click the Todoist icon in your extensions bar in the top right. A compact view of Todoist will appear:
This view is a great way to save time: you can access any of Todoist’s features without having to leave your current web page.
Add a website as a task by right-clicking
- Go to the website you’d like to add as a task.
- Right-click anywhere on the page and select Add to Todoist. The task will be added to your Todoist Inbox with a link back to the page.
Add a website as a task using Quick Add
You can also add the website as a task by using quick add:
- Click the Todoist icon in your extensions bar in the top right.
- Click + to open Quick Add.
- Click Add website as task at the bottom to add the page title and URL as the task name.
- Add any other task details you like, a due date for example.
- Click Add task to save the task.
You can also select any text on the page, then right-click on it and select Add to Todoist. The selected text will then be used as the name for the newly created task.
FAQ
Can I use the Firefox extension in a private window?
Yes, here's how you can do this:
- Click on the hamburger menu icon in the top-right corner of the browser.
- Select Add-ons and themes.
- Select Extensions.
- Click on the Todoist extension.
- Next to Run in Private Windows select Allow.
